There is no single Bank of America routing number; the number is determined by in which state the account is opened - the number for CA is different than KY which is different than NC, etc etc.
People with a lower credit rating score present a higher risk to lenders than those with a higher credit rating score. Therefore, those who present the highest risk will receive the highest interest rates and those who present the lowest risk will receive the lowest interest rates. While this may not seem fair, the bank sees someone with a 650 credit rating score as a higher risk of defaulting on their loan than a person with a 750 credit score. This is because, statistically speaking, those with a 750 credit rating score do default less than those who a 650 score.
